Marisha Pessl is an American author born in Asheville, North Carolina.
Her debut novel, Special Topics in Calamity Physics, was published in 2006 to critical acclaim, becoming a bestseller and winning the John Sargent Sr. First Novel Prize.
It was also selected as one of the 10 Best Books of the Year by The New York Times Book Review.
Pessl's second novel, Night Film, was released in 2013 and garnered significant attention for its innovative storytelling techniques and suspenseful plot.
Pessl now resides in New York City and maintains an active presence on social media, engaging with her readers through her official Facebook page.
